Websites hosted on 154.89.82.6 IP Address

Geo Location Information for 154.89.82.6 IP Address. The IP Address 154.89.82.6 is located at 22.2909 latitude and 114.15 longitude in Hong Kong SAR China. Friendly Location for the IP Address is Central and Western District, Central, Hong Kong


120hfpf.top
- 120hfpf.top

120hfpf.top alexa Not Applicable   120hfpf.top worth $ 8.95

fz95536.top
- fz95536.top

fz95536.top alexa Not Applicable   fz95536.top worth $ 8.95

请求目标站发生错误,当前请求IP:
- pidsys7.top

pidsys7.top alexa Not Applicable   pidsys7.top worth $ 8.95

88娱城官网手机版|官网
- pj88806.top

88娱城官网手机版【t39.com】卐88娱城下载公司投注资金雄厚,大额提款最有保证,是亚洲最大的娱乐平台。⊙觅来-是一家专注正品特卖的时尚购物平台,致力于为广大消费者提供最专业可信的购物体验,主要经营美妆、箱包、服装、3C数码、腕表、母婴等产品.

pj88806.top alexa Not Applicable   pj88806.top worth $ 8.95

gmhb668.top
- gmhb668.top

gmhb668.top alexa Not Applicable   gmhb668.top worth $ 8.95

ForaStat is a free tool which helps analyse websites and estimate valuation including such as Search Engine Reports, Traffic Reports, Social Engagement, Safety, Host Information, Domain WHOIS, Page Speed and much more.